Sat, 9 December 2006 ![]() Each year Eric puts together a Christmas compilation for friends. This episode contains the songs on this year's collection. Songs include "Christmas in the Stars" from the Star Wars Christmas Album, "Jingle Bells" by Sammy Davis Jr., "Santa Claus is Coming to Town" from Smokey Robinson and the Miracles, The Chipmunks with "Hang Up Your Stockin'," "I Hate Christmas" sung by Oscar the Grouch, "C-h-r-i-s-t-m-a-s" from Jim Reeves, Jimmy Donley with "Santa! Don't Pass Me By,"Sleigh Bells, Reindeer, And Snow" from Rita Faye Wilson, "Dead, Dead, Dead" from the South Park Christmas album, Soul Coughing with "Suzy Snowflake, Sufjan Stevens' version of "Holy, Holy, Holy," Judy Garland singing "Have Yourself A Merry Little Christmas, "One Little Christmas Tree" from Stevie Wonder, the mash-up "Jingle Jane," "sleigh Ride" from Bootsy Collins, Count Floyd and "Reggae Christmas Eve In Transylvania," "Frosty the Snowman" as performed by Los Straitjackets, "Santa's Second Line" by New Birth Brass Band, "Grandma's Christmas Card" from Merle Haggard, Peggy Lee and "White Christmas," "The Peace Carol" from John Denver & The Muppets, Neil Diamond doing "Silver Bells," "That Was the Worst Christmas Ever!" by Sufjan Stevens, and Pizzicato Five singing "Silent Night." Wed, 23 August 2006 As the nights get shorter, a podcast of songs celebrating summer. Music includes "Summer Breeze" by The Reflections, "World Of Summer" Love Jones, Sly & The Family Stone with "Hot Fun In The Summertime," "Freedom Summer" by Har Mar Superstar, Jane's Addicition with "Summertime Rolls," "Summer Fever" by 15 60 75--The Numbers Band, Love with "Bummer In The Summer," "Unemployed In Summertime" by Emiliana Torrini, "Summertime" by Bobby Montez, Yoshinori Sunahara's "Summer," "Hot Hot Summer Day" by The Sugarhill Gang, and "I Write Summer Songs For No Reason" by The Acid House Kings. Tue, 11 April 2006 This episode features songs where a lot happens in a very quiet musical place. Songs include "Peanut Dreams" by Grand National, "Couldn't Sleep" by Milosh, "Marching The Hate Machines Into The Sun" by Thievery Corporation, "Song To The Siren" by Tim Buckley, "Galaxies" by Laura Veirs, "Turn Away" by Moving Units, "Your Ghost" by Kristin Hersh, "Like Pictures Part 2" by Brian Eno, "Still Light" by The Knife, "Great Waves" by Dirty Three, and "Answered Prayers" by David Sylvian.
